Egypt has requested Indonesia to send field hospitals to treat wounded Gazan refugees and to postpone the deployment of a hospital ship due to space constraints at Egyptian ports.
efense Minister Prabowo Subianto said on Friday that Egypt had requested Indonesia to provide field hospitals to treat wounded refugees from Gaza as Israel continues its all-out assault on the besieged Palestinian territory.
“I will ask for direction from President Joko “Jokowi” Widodo on the request,” Prabowo said at the Atang Sendaja Air Force Base in Kemang district, Bogor regency, West Java, on Friday.
“We will discuss whether or not to send field hospitals. But one thing for sure, there was a request to delay the hospital ship deployment because the Egyptian defense minister said they could not accommodate it in the next few weeks.”
Prabowo was speaking on the sidelines of a handover ceremony of eight H225 heavy transport helicopters to the Air Force’s 8th Squadron.
Prabowo said his office had coordinated with Egyptian Defense Minister Mohamed Ahmed Zaki about Indonesia sending humanitarian relief for Palestinians, including ships carrying the aid.
“The Egyptian defense minister asked us to hold the shipment because there are so many ships waiting to berth, as they are carrying food and other supplies,” said Prabowo.
Despite so many ships queuing to berth, Egypt said more food aid was still required.
